What is Naproxen?

Naproxen is an anti-inflammatory painkiller used to treat pain, stiffness, and swelling caused by arthritis, menstrual cramps, gout, or soft-tissue injuries. It provides longer-lasting relief compared to some other NSAIDs.

Naproxen is commonly recommended when paracetamol or ibuprofen do not provide sufficient relief, particularly in conditions involving persistent inflammation such as osteoarthritis, tendonitis, and chronic back pain.

How Does It Work?

Naproxen blocks the enzyme cyclooxygenase (COX), which produces prostaglandins — chemicals that cause pain, swelling, and fever. By reducing these chemicals, Naproxen lowers inflammation and discomfort.

This action helps improve mobility and function, making daily activities easier for people living with chronic pain conditions.

How Long Does It Take to Work?

Most people notice relief within 1 to 2 hours of taking Naproxen. It’s best taken with food or milk to reduce stomach irritation.

Peak anti-inflammatory effects may develop after a few days of regular use for long-term conditions like arthritis.

How Long Does It Last?

Each dose typically provides relief for 8–12 hours, making it a twice-daily treatment for ongoing pain control. Its longer duration is particularly helpful overnight, where joint stiffness and inflammation can otherwise interrupt sleep.

Use with caution if you have high blood pressure, asthma, or are taking blood thinners or other anti-inflammatory medicines.

Naproxen may increase the risk of cardiovascular events (such as heart attack or stroke) in long-term high-dose users, so regular medical supervision is important.
